Consider a particle of charge Q, moving perpendicular to a magnetic field of flux density B with a velocity v. Show that it will be deflected in a circular path, radius r, where:


r=p/BQ and p is the momentum of the charged particle.

F=maqvB=mv2rqB=mvrr=mvqB=pqBF=ma\to qvB=m\frac{v^2}{r}\to qB=\frac{mv}{r}\to r=\frac{mv}{qB}=\frac{p}{qB}


So, r=pqBr=\frac{p}{qB} . Answer
